Aviation GPS Systems

Friday, February 27th, 2009

Garmin 396 is a global position system designed for the aircrafts. This multi feature device is an ideal match for aircraft’s cockpit and also serves as a good navigator for the pilot. Ranked under the category of most reliable GPS systems, it is packed with XM Weather mapping technology, besides, METARs, TFRs, TAFs, satellite imagery and much more. The GPS comes in sunlight-viewable, 256 color TFT screen and incorporated with ultra modern TAWS-style audio terrain alerts. Garmin 396 is full of potential capabilities that give the pilots a wonderful adventure in air through its full Jeppesen aviation database and more than 150 XM Radio stations.

Another GPS model from Garmin is slightly less advanced than the 396 GPS model. The garmin 296 GPS model is featured with “Terrain” mode that gives the pilots with almost TAWS-like warnings, just like advanced 396 GPS model, but truly lacks whopping 150 XM radio stations. Garmin 296 is packed with automotive facility mode that allows the pilot to give accurate directions after landing. The automatic-routing feature similar to the one as seen in the car navigation system also allows the pilot to make the inspection of the land for any crevices or holes. What’s more, the GPS has high-speed 200-Mhz processor that helps in making fast map redraws.

Scientists see boom for biotechnology

Saturday, February 14th, 2009

The promising potential of biotechnology remains largely unused, especially in such crucial areas as healthcare and production of environmentally friendly fuels, scientists said.

The experts gathered here at an annual conference of the American Association for the Advancement of Science predicted that biotechnology was likely to experience a boom in coming years.

“What you have seen over the last 35 years of biotech are tremendous applications, immediate applications of biotech starting with recombinant therapeutics all the way through,” said Drew Endy, assistant professor of bioengineering at Stanford University.

He said the phenomenon can be explained by the fact that no one thus far has even “scratched the surface” of the promising science.

But Endy argued that science was moving forward fast. In only six years, he said, the gene sequencing project went from reading a bacteria genome to reading a human genome.

Last year, researchers at the Venter Institute built a bacteria genome from scratch, he noted.

“I bet we will be able to construct a human chromosome, and the yeast genome,” Endy said, offering a six-year forecast. “It sounds a little bit crazy because it’s an exponential improvement in the tools.”

He said there were lots of opportunities to take those tools forward.

“We are advocating now a national initiative in synthetic biology that would include in part a route map for getting better in building genetic material, constructing DNA from scratch and assembling it into genes and genomes,” the scientist pointed out.

Jay Keasling, professor of biochemical engineering at the University of California at Berkeley, said his project was using a microbe in order to produce a drug while significantly reducing its cost.

“We anticipate in one or two years that the optimization process will be completed and that production of the drug will commence and have it in the hands of people in Africa shortly thereafter,” Keasling said.

Meanwhile, Christina Smolke, assistant professor of bioengineering at Stanford University spoke about her efforts to design molecules that go into the cell and analyse the cellular state before delivering a therapeutic effect.

“Our goal is to make more effective therapies by taking advantage of the natural capabilities of our immune system and introducing slight modifications in cases where it is not doing what we would like it to do,” she said.

Smolke said she hoped to translate her technologies into intelligent cellular therapeutics for glioma cancer patients in the next five years.

“That’s a very optimistic view …but so far things are moving quickly,” she pointed out.

Leak: Amazon Kindle 2 Pictures and Pricing

Saturday, February 7th, 2009

Official-looking pictures and pricing of Amazon’s Kindle 2 e-book reader have been leaked on the Internet. The information surfaced on a forum late last night and reveals a thinner Kindle but without the speculated price increase. Amazon is expected to officially announce the Kindle 2 during a press conference on Monday.

Improvements in the Kindle 2 design bring a thinner footprint, a metal back plate and stereo speakers. As I mentioned last October, when the first Kindle 2 pictures surfaced, the design cues bring back memories of the first Apple iPods. As usual, the information is purely speculative but the forum reads that Kindle 2 will be available on February 24 for $359.

Kindle 2 features rounded corners, a black and white screen (apparently the same size as the original Kindle), a 3.5mm headphone jack with a sliding sleep button at the top and a unified QWERTY keyboard under the screen. Smaller navigation buttons are placed on both the left and right sides of Kindle 2. A joystick now replaces the original Kindle scroll wheel.

Amazon’s new Kindle will use the same EV-DO wireless technology for over-the-air downloads as the original. Storage wise, Kindle 2 is said to come with a 2GB on-board memory. Form the leaked pictures, no SD card slot can be seen but my guess is that there will be a way to expand Kindle’s memory - maybe a microSD slot.

The Nation’s Weather

Wednesday, February 4th, 2009

A few lingering snow showers were poised to hit the mid-Atlantic coast and Great Lakes early Wednesday, while much of the West was sunny and mild.

A low pressure system will extend down the East Coast and into the Southeast, but is not expected to trigger any showers. Expect cold and dry conditions to continue.

New England will continue to see light snow, with well below an inch of total accumulation. Virginia and North Carolina also were to see show.

High pressure over the Plains will allow for winds out of the northwest over the Great Lakes, which will continue to kick up light lake-effect snow over the region. Expect total accumulation between 1 to 3 inches over northern Michigan, Ohio, Pennsylvania and New York.

Highs near 10, with below freezing lows, are anticipated as this system pulls in cold air from Canada. The Plains will remain mostly sunny and cold on Wednesday.

In the West, high pressure will allow for plenty of sunshine and warm conditions. By Wednesday evening, a low pressure system will approach California and is expected to bring increasingly cloudy skies.

Temperatures in the Lower 48 states on Tuesday ranged from a low of minus 27 degrees at Fosston, Minn., to a high of 84 degrees at Chino, Calif.
